Israel kills five unarmed Palestinians in Gaza

Israeli forces in the Gaza Strip have shot dead five unarmed Palestinians.

A Israeli military source claimed the Palestinians were planning to climb a border fence to get into Israel.

Israeli soldiers arrest two men in the West Bank. Five unarmed Palestinians were shot dead earlier today by Israeli forces in the Gaza Strip.

"This area is barred to Palestinian traffic and there were specific warnings that an infiltration attempt would be carried out in this area," the source claimed.

The source said the Israeli forces opened fire and found the bodies of five Palestinians in a search in the morning.

"They were found with ladders, apparently having planned to get over the border fence, but no weapons were found".

At least 1,717 Palestinians and 668 Israelis have been killed since the start of a Palestinian uprising for statehood in September 2000 after peace talks failed.
